Welcome to the Loomworks migration. We're moving legacy cron jobs into the Tidewheel workflow engine one queue at a time. Reviewers: check that each converted job declares idempotency and a retry budget; reject anything still shelling out to the old scheduler. To access the staging scheduler during review, use the recovery passphrase below.

strongbox words: holix-praax

## Releases

Crashfold builds ship from the `release/*` branches only. The pipeline symbolicates reports against the uploaded dSYM bundle before tagging; if symbolication fails, the release is blocked. Versioning follows build-number monotonicity enforced by the Lintmarsh CI gate. Reviewers: confirm the crash-report redaction pass ran (check the `scrub-ok` artifact) before approving. Hotfixes skip staging but never skip redaction. All release artifacts must be signed before upload. Use the key below.

deploy key for kajof-fajop: bky6_gDHw9Q

## Formula sandbox tuning

User-supplied formulas in Gridmoor execute inside a restricted interpreter with hard ceilings on time, memory, and call depth. Reviewers should confirm any change to these ceilings is justified in the PR description, since raising them widens the abuse surface. Defaults were chosen from production traces. The current limits are as follows.

limits module of tafog-fawip:
WEIGHTS = {
    "julix": 57,
    "lamys": 992,
    "kasvan": 209,
    "quenok": 750,
    "alddor": 259,
    "oliath": 1009,
    "wenix": 815,
}